-MSD 6010 and MSD 8886:

The PN 6010 Ignition Controller is designed for GM Gen III engines that have been retro-fit with an intake manifold and carburetor. The Controller can also be used in stock, EFI applications, by using accessory Harness PN 8886. The factory coils or MSD Coil, PN 8245, must be used. The Controller is supplied with a wiring harness that connects to the factory connectors for a simple
installation.
